한국생산성본부

최근 검색어
인기 검색어
닫기

교육

지수

자격인증

접기/펴기

자바 디자인패턴 마스터

교육상세 옵션정보
교육일정
  근로자주도
교육시간 3일, 21시간
교육장소 한국생산성본부 8층 806호
고용보험 고용보험 비환급 ?
※ "환급/비환급" 표시는 근로자주도훈련 지원 여부와 무관합니다.
교육비
정상가 770,000 원 KPC 유료법인회원 720,000 원
교육문의 ICT교육센터 02-724-1218 / sjkim@kpc.or.kr / 결제·계산서문의 : 02-724-1212
 

교육목적/특징



[교육특징]

■ 실무 중심의 디자인 패턴 학습: 자바 개발 실무에서 자주 사용하는 디자인 패턴을 이해하고 적용하여, 코드의 구조를 개선하고 유지보수성을 높일 수 있는 역량을 배양합니다.

■ 클린 코드와 디자인 패턴의 통합: 클린 코드 원칙과 디자인 패턴을 결합해 가독성이 높고 유지보수하기 쉬운 소프트웨어를 설계하고 구현할 수 있도록 학습합니다.

■ 객체지향 설계 개선: 객체지향 설계 원칙을 기반으로 코드의 유연성과 확장성을 강화할 수 있는 실질적인 설계 및 구현 방법을 익힙니다.

 

[교육목표]

■ 디자인 패턴 활용 능력 강화: 복잡한 소프트웨어 설계를 체계적으로 해결할 수 있는 디자인 패턴을 이해하고, 실무에서 바로 활용할 수 있는 능력을 기릅니다.

■ 클린 코드 작성 역량 향상: 클린 코드 원칙을 적용해 가독성과 효율성을 높인 유지보수 가능한 코드를 작성할 수 있는 역량을 배양합니다.

■ 유지보수성과 확장성 높은 프로그램 개발: 자바 디자인 패턴을 활용하여 유지보수성과 확장성이 뛰어난 소프트웨어를 설계하고 구현하는 능력을 갖춥니다.




교육대상

■ 자바 기본 문법을 이해하고 간단한 프로그램 경험이 있는 분

■ 실무에서 디자인 패턴을 활용해 더 효율적인 코드 작성을 원하는 분

■ 클린 코드 원칙을 적용해 유지보수하기 쉬운 코드를 작성하려는 분

■ 객체지향 설계와 디자인 패턴의 활용 방법을 심화 학습하려는 자바 개발자

*객체지향 설계의 핵심인 디자인 패턴을 완벽히 이해하고, 효율적이고 재사용 가능한 코드를 작성할 수 있는 역량을 키워보세요!




교육내용

일자별 교육내용을 나타낸 표입니다.

구분

내용

[1일차]

클린코드와 생성 패턴 

ㅇ 클린 코드 
  - 클린 코드의 중요성과 실무 적용 방법
  - 코드 가독성, 유지보수성 향상 기법
ㅇ 싱글턴 패턴
  - 하나의 인스터만 존재하도록 보장하는 패턴
ㅇ 팩토리 패턴
  - 객체 생성 로직을 캡슐화하여 유연한 객체 생성
ㅇ 빌더 패턴
  - 복잡한 객체 생성을 단계별로 처리하여 가독성 향상
ㅇ 프로토타입 패턴
  - 기존 객체를 복제하여 성능 향상 및 메모리 절약

[2일차]

구조 패턴

ㅇ 어댑터 패턴
  - 서로 다른 인터페이스 간의 호환성을 제공하는 패턴
ㅇ 프록시 패턴
  - 접근 제어, 로깅, 지연 초기화 등을 위해 설제 객체 대신 사용
ㅇ 데코레이터 패턴
  - 객체의 기능을 동적으로 추가하는 패턴
ㅇ 피사드 패턴
  - 복잡한 시스템을 간단하게 사용하도록 단일 인터페이스 제공

[3일차]

행동 패턴

ㅇ 전략  패턴
  - 런타임에 알고리즘을 동적으로 선택하고 교체하는 패턴
ㅇ 옵저버 패턴
  - 객체 상태 변화를 감지하고 자동으로 알림 전달 패턴
ㅇ 커맨드 패턴
  - 명령을 객체로 캡슐화하여 실행 및 취소 기능 제공
ㅇ 템플릿 패턴
  - 알고리즘 구조를 정의하고 세부 구현을 하위에서 처리

 *본 교육과정은 개강일 기준으로 약 7일 전 개강 여부를 확정하며, 최소한의 수강생이 모이지 않을 경우 폐강될 수도 있음을 알려드립니다.
(수강신청 완료자분들을 대상으로 개강일 기준 약 7일 전 문자/메일로 안내드리고 있습니다.)

수강후기

sc****

2025-05-09

굉장히 열정적이시고, 전문지식도 풍부해보입니다. 교육에 적극적이십니다
sc****

2025-05-09

내용도 좋고,강사님도 좋아요.

연관 자격

자격증명 자격증관련링크

자바 디자인패턴 마스터

2025-12-15~2025-12-17

 
한국생산성본부

슬기로운 직장생활을 위한 한국생산성본부 교육과정 상세 안내

과정명 : 자바 디자인패턴 마스터

교육일정 2025-12-15 ~ 2025-12-17 교육시간 09:30 : 17:30 교육장소 한국생산성본부 8층 806호
교육비 지원 고용보험 비환급 담당자 ICT교육센터 02-724-1218 / sjkim@kpc.or.kr / 결제·계산서문의 : 02-724-1212

교육비

정상가 KPC회원(일반,특별)
770,000원 770,000원 720,000원

※ 2일이하 과정은 산업인력공단 실시신고 등록마감으로 인해 훈련 개시 1일전(근무일기준) 18:00까지 신청할 수 있습니다.

상세안내

교육목적/특징



[교육특징]

■ 실무 중심의 디자인 패턴 학습: 자바 개발 실무에서 자주 사용하는 디자인 패턴을 이해하고 적용하여, 코드의 구조를 개선하고 유지보수성을 높일 수 있는 역량을 배양합니다.

■ 클린 코드와 디자인 패턴의 통합: 클린 코드 원칙과 디자인 패턴을 결합해 가독성이 높고 유지보수하기 쉬운 소프트웨어를 설계하고 구현할 수 있도록 학습합니다.

■ 객체지향 설계 개선: 객체지향 설계 원칙을 기반으로 코드의 유연성과 확장성을 강화할 수 있는 실질적인 설계 및 구현 방법을 익힙니다.

 

[교육목표]

■ 디자인 패턴 활용 능력 강화: 복잡한 소프트웨어 설계를 체계적으로 해결할 수 있는 디자인 패턴을 이해하고, 실무에서 바로 활용할 수 있는 능력을 기릅니다.

■ 클린 코드 작성 역량 향상: 클린 코드 원칙을 적용해 가독성과 효율성을 높인 유지보수 가능한 코드를 작성할 수 있는 역량을 배양합니다.

■ 유지보수성과 확장성 높은 프로그램 개발: 자바 디자인 패턴을 활용하여 유지보수성과 확장성이 뛰어난 소프트웨어를 설계하고 구현하는 능력을 갖춥니다.

교육대상

■ 자바 기본 문법을 이해하고 간단한 프로그램 경험이 있는 분

■ 실무에서 디자인 패턴을 활용해 더 효율적인 코드 작성을 원하는 분

■ 클린 코드 원칙을 적용해 유지보수하기 쉬운 코드를 작성하려는 분

■ 객체지향 설계와 디자인 패턴의 활용 방법을 심화 학습하려는 자바 개발자

*객체지향 설계의 핵심인 디자인 패턴을 완벽히 이해하고, 효율적이고 재사용 가능한 코드를 작성할 수 있는 역량을 키워보세요!

교육내용

일자별 교육내용을 나타낸 표입니다.

구분

내용

[1일차]

클린코드와 생성 패턴 

ㅇ 클린 코드 
  - 클린 코드의 중요성과 실무 적용 방법
  - 코드 가독성, 유지보수성 향상 기법
ㅇ 싱글턴 패턴
  - 하나의 인스터만 존재하도록 보장하는 패턴
ㅇ 팩토리 패턴
  - 객체 생성 로직을 캡슐화하여 유연한 객체 생성
ㅇ 빌더 패턴
  - 복잡한 객체 생성을 단계별로 처리하여 가독성 향상
ㅇ 프로토타입 패턴
  - 기존 객체를 복제하여 성능 향상 및 메모리 절약

[2일차]

구조 패턴

ㅇ 어댑터 패턴
  - 서로 다른 인터페이스 간의 호환성을 제공하는 패턴
ㅇ 프록시 패턴
  - 접근 제어, 로깅, 지연 초기화 등을 위해 설제 객체 대신 사용
ㅇ 데코레이터 패턴
  - 객체의 기능을 동적으로 추가하는 패턴
ㅇ 피사드 패턴
  - 복잡한 시스템을 간단하게 사용하도록 단일 인터페이스 제공

[3일차]

행동 패턴

ㅇ 전략  패턴
  - 런타임에 알고리즘을 동적으로 선택하고 교체하는 패턴
ㅇ 옵저버 패턴
  - 객체 상태 변화를 감지하고 자동으로 알림 전달 패턴
ㅇ 커맨드 패턴
  - 명령을 객체로 캡슐화하여 실행 및 취소 기능 제공
ㅇ 템플릿 패턴
  - 알고리즘 구조를 정의하고 세부 구현을 하위에서 처리

 *본 교육과정은 개강일 기준으로 약 7일 전 개강 여부를 확정하며, 최소한의 수강생이 모이지 않을 경우 폐강될 수도 있음을 알려드립니다.
(수강신청 완료자분들을 대상으로 개강일 기준 약 7일 전 문자/메일로 안내드리고 있습니다.)

한국생산성본부

우) 03170 서울시 종로구 새문안로5가길 32 생산성빌딩
Copyright ⓒ Korea Productivity Center. All Rights Reserved.